Window Tint
The standard is 30% however did you ever wonder how "others" got away with more. If you have a reason such as a skin condition and a doctor's note you can apply to increase the tint on the windows.

30% is the legal MAX tint can put in ur car .. any thing above u will get a fine ( 600-900) dhs ...
10,000 dhs fine is if u use 100% tint or reflector tint or if u put tint allover the front window ..regardless of the percentage( clear tint is ok )
thats last time i checked ..
